AbstractChemically modified electrodes are prepared by deposition of copper hexacyanoferrate (CuHCF) on glassy carbon. These electrodes are characterized by voltammetric and potentiometric measurements. After suitable conditioning they exhibit nearly Nernstian response to changes in activity of potassium or ammonium ions as well as good selectivity with respect to sodium ions. The kinetics of potassium ion exchange between the CuHCF film and aqueous solutions is studied and the diffusion coefficient of potassium ion in CuHCF is determined.
